ABSTRACT:
A retainer for ball bearings includes mating plastic members (4,5) having undulating shape and adapted to accommodate a plurality of balls (3) therebetween. One of the mating plastic members (4) has a mating edge provided with recesses (9) formed therein adapted to accommodate corresponding protrusions (10) formed on the other mating plastic member (5). The plastic members (4,5) are secured together, preferably by ultrasonic welding.
